State two conditions for a body, acted upon by several forces to be in equilibrium.

The two conditions for a body to be in equilibrium are

  1. The resultant of all the forces acting on a body should be zero.

  2. The algebraic sum of moments of all the forces acting on the body about the point of rotation should be zero.
